Mega Chompies[1] are silver, red armor wearing Chompies that have the ability to grow into a giant Chompy and spawn regular Chompies. In 3DS version of Trap Team, one Mega Chompy, Big Bertha Bubblethorn, is trappable.
One giant Mega Chompy boss is seen in the Chompy Mountain track of Skylanders: SuperChargers Racing while others can be seen skiing and skating in the Trollympic Village track which also has some golden statues of Mega Chompies along the sides.
